ARM-P stands for the Associate in Risk Management for Public Entities and is a certification allowing insurance industry professionals to take on governmental clients. Here are some of the potential benefits you may get by earning this certification:
- Broaden risk management perspective through an understanding of unique risk management needs for public entities
- Help manage claims and litigation costs by gaining knowledge of the legal environment of public entities
- Develop a holistic view of public entity risk management by understanding specific stakeholders and their expectations
Most ARM-P prep classes begin by reviewing the basic structure and content of each of the exams you need to take in order to earn certification. The RMPE 352 exam is the one that most directly deals with public sector risk management. Here are some of the topics you might see on the test:
- Public and Private Sector Risk Management Contracts
- The Public Sector Environment
- Risk Management in Local Governments
- Common Public Sector Exposures
- The Distinctive Legal Status of Public Entities
- The Distinctive Liability Exposures of Public Entities
- Approaches to Public Entity Risk Control
- Claim Processing Procedures
- Claim History and Record Keeping
- Litigation Management
